Originally Posted by Flaco
no girdle, stock cover, motive gears..
they told me i needed a parachute i am going to put a "GLAD" trashbag for my next run...LOL
A girdle, studs will help keep the caps from flexing, and high gear like a 3.42, 3.23 will give a larger pinion with more contact area. Are the axles stock?
